The Faculty of Economics at the University of Montenegro hosted students and professors from the Hamburg School of Business Administration (HSBA) as part of their study trip. After an introduction to the rich history of the faculty and its future development directions, the guests were welcomed by the Vice Dean for International Cooperation and coordinator of the Erasmus+ project "ME Study in English," Dr. Tamara Backović, who expressed her pleasure regarding the visit.

During the visit, which took place as part of the Erasmus+ project activities, Dr. Milica Muhadinović delivered a lecture on "Economies on the Path to the EU – Opportunities and Challenges." This topic particularly interested the students, providing them with insights into the perspectives of a country undergoing the EU accession process. The lecture was held in the new Millennium Hall, where students had the chance to deepen their knowledge and actively participate in a discussion on current economic issues.

After the lecture, the gathering continued at the Student, Alumni, and Faculty Club, where Economics students met with the guests from Germany. The host of this meeting, Zerina Kardović, President of the Student Union of the Faculty of Economics, emphasized the importance of such events for exchanging experiences and creating new academic and professional connections.

HSBA (Hamburg School of Business Administration) is a university specializing in business studies. It was established in 2004 by the Hamburg Chamber of Commerce and is accredited by FIBAA (Foundation for International Business Administration Accreditation). This university stands out for its dual study programs, which combine academic education with practical work in companies.

Promoting the internationalization of higher education institutions in Montenegro through the development of capacity for study programs in English (ME-Study in English) is an Erasmus+ structural project coordinated by the Faculty of Economics at the University of Montenegro. The project aims to build capacity in higher education (Erasmus+ CBHE) and enhance the process of internationalization of higher education institutions in Montenegro, ultimately resulting in an increase in the number of study programs offered in English.
